    Last Summer next Winter the year before last / A man with a hammer stood breaking his fast.

    Last Summer next Winter the year before last
    A man with a hammer stood breaking his fast
    Some cast iron cheese cakes he tried hard to eat
    But those cakes they fell down and
    broke the corns in his feet.
    II
    He went to the doctor and stated
    his case
    The hot tears from his eyes burned
    holes in his face
    The doctor filled those holes up with
    sawdust and tar
    And it was with a football match
    he lit his cigar
    He washed his feet with some "russian
    salac"
    Which made the hair grow down on
    the neck of his back
    III
    This man had a father so some
